#45015f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#45015f is composed of 27.1% red, 0.4%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.4% cyan, 98.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 62.7% black. It has a hue angle of 283.4 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 18.8%. #45015f color hex could be obtained by blending #8a02be with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#45015f color description : Very dark violet.

#45015f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#45015f has RGB values of R:69, G:1,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 4522335.

Shades and Tints of #45015f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0011 is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#45015f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#312d33 is the less saturated color, while #45015f is the most saturated one.
